ADVANCED ACCOUNTING, 7e, by Hoyle/Schaefer/Doupnik is a solid revision to a successful and comprehensive text known for its ample integration of real world examples, student orientation, and popular writing style. Additional real world content, Internet Assignments and an expanded web site make the text even more pedagogically sound and appealing to users. Coverage of all recent FASB and GASB proclamations keep the seventh edition of Hoyle/Schaefer/Doupnik current.

Joe B. Hoyle is Associate Professor of Accounting at the Robins School of Business at the University of Richmond, where he teaches Intermediate Accounting I and II and Advanced Accounting. He is currently the David Meade White Distinguished Teaching Fellow. He has been named a Distinguished Educator five times and Professor of the Year on two occasions. He is also author of Fast Track CPA Examination Review and coauthor of The Lakeside Company Case Studies in Auditing.
